The Future of Energy – Arendalsuka 2021

17. August 2021 / 08.00 AM – 10.15 AM / Gard, Kittelsbuktveien 31, Arendal 

The Future of Energy treats energy in a global perspective, Norway’s role as an international energy supplier, and the effect that ongoing economic, geopolitical and sustainability trends have for Norwegian industry and businesses.

Development of new energy sources such as hydrogen and offshore wind, and low-emission solutions such as carbon capture and storage, will also be presented.
